## Document Transport – Courier Change

Following the missed pick-up on Tuesday by Lorrix Express, all outbound document pouches from the Haverdale warehouse now go with Pinefield Couriers, effective immediately. The Lorrix account remains open only for inbound returns until month-end.

Shift leads must log each pouch in the transport book before the 14:30 cut-off and keep pouches in the secure cage until the Pinefield driver arrives. The hand-over instruction below applies to every Pinefield collection:

handover note for yagef-bagep: the drudor pelius courier leaves the kasdor zorvan norir ledger at gate 8016 under passcode 755406

**Audit item 7 — Customer record deduplication.** Confirm the Lanternfold dedup job ran against the full Harbinger customer table this quarter, not just the incremental slice. Verify the fuzzy-match threshold remains at 0.92 and that merge decisions below that score were routed to manual review. Spot-check twenty merged pairs for false positives, and confirm the rollback snapshot exists before any merge batch commits. Document any threshold changes in the audit log. The maintainer accountable for this item is recorded below.

account owner for kafop-haweg: Pelax Gilael Istir

## Authentication

The SpoolHart microservice requires a bearer token on every request to its job-queue endpoints. Tokens are minted by the Printwell admin console and expire after 30 days. Support staff diagnosing stuck spools should use the shared read-only token rather than requesting personal credentials, since read-only access covers queue inspection, job history, and printer status. Write operations such as purge and requeue need an elevated token. The current read-only support token is shown below.

login token, hahif-bajog: eyJhbGciOiJIUzI1NiIsInR5cCI6IkpXVCJ9.eyJzdWIiOiIHJXUrbIn0.JC-NFEAJ

Subject: Profile-store cut-over — done!

Hi Marit,

Good news: the Pellwick profile store is fully sharded as of last night. All four shards took traffic cleanly, replication lag stayed under a second, and we kept the old store read-only as a fallback for a week. For the release notes, here's the final shard configuration we landed on.

service settings:
[casax]
port = 6379
team = rusir
host = casax.zemvarhq.corp
region = outer-4
access_code = ac_9808ce
timeout_ms = 1500